Kinds Of Driving Licenses in Poland
Before diving into the services related to obtaining a driving license, it is vital to comprehend the types of licenses readily available.

| License Category | Description | Validity Period |
|---|---|---|
| AM | Motor scooters and mopeds (approximately 50cc) | 15 years |
| A1 | Motorcycles with engine capacity up to 125cc | 15 years |
| A2 | Motorbikes with a power limitation of approximately 35 kW | 15 years |
| A | Any bike (unrestricted) | 15 years |
| B | Vehicles (up to 3.5 tonnes, max. 9 seats including driver) | 15 years |
| B+E | Mix of automobiles (cars and truck with trailer exceeding 750kg) | 15 years |
| C | Automobiles above 3.5 tonnes (trucks) | 5 years |
| C+E | Mix of automobiles (truck with trailer) | 5 years |
| D | Buses (more than 9 seats consisting of driver) | 5 years |
| D+E | Mix of lorries (bus with trailer) | 5 years |
Actions to Obtain a Driving License in Poland
The process of getting a driving license involves numerous stages. Below is a breakdown of actions that people need to follow:
Meet Eligibility Requirements: Before applying, ensure you meet the minimum age and have a legitimate identification document.
Register for a Theoretical Course: This is the initial step for B and A categories. Trainees should enroll in a qualified driving school where they will discover the rules of the road and traffic regulations.
Pass the Theoretical Exam: Upon completion of the theoretical course, prospects need to pass an official exam that evaluates their understanding.
Go To Practical Driving Lessons: After passing the theoretical exam, candidates need to take practical lessons with an approved driving trainer.
Pass the Practical Driving Exam: Candidates need to successfully complete a practical driving test in a designated lorry.
Submit Required Documentation: This consists of identity confirmation, medical certificates, and evidence of finished courses.
Pay Applicable Fees: It is vital to confirm the most current charge structure as these can vary.
Receive Your Driving License: If successful, candidates will receive their driving license within a specified duration.
Needed Documents for License Application
| File | Description |
|---|---|
| Legitimate ID (Passport/National ID) | Proof of identity |
| Medical Certificate | Issued by a licensed physician confirming physical fitness to drive |
| Proof of Residency | Document describing present real estate situation |
| Certificate of Completed Course | From an accredited driving school |
| Payment Confirmation | Invoice of driving license application cost |
Fees Associated with Driving License Services
Driving license fees can vary based on the type of license being obtained, as well as the specific city in Poland. Below is a table summing up typical costs connected with obtaining a driving license:
| Service | Approximate Cost (PLN) |
|---|---|
| Theoretical Exam | 30-50 PLN |
| Practical Exam | 140-200 PLN |
| Driving School Course (B category) | 2000-3000 PLN |
| Medical examination | 100-200 PLN |
| Driving License Issuance | 100-200 PLN |

FAQs about Driving License Services in Poland
1. Who can request a driving license in Poland?
Anyone who (1) fulfills the age requirement, (2) holds a valid type of recognition, and (3) has actually passed the required exams can make an application for a driving license.
2. What is the minimum age to obtain a driving license?
The minimum age varies by license category:
- 14 for AM licenses,
- 16 for A1 and B licenses,
- 18 for A and C licenses.
3. The length of time does the driving license application process take?
The whole process can take a number of months, particularly if you consist of classroom direction. It differs based upon specific development and schedule of driving exam slots.
4. Exists any validity duration for medical certificates?
Yes, the medical certificate is normally legitimate for 5 years, however this differs for expert motorists.
5. Can I drive in Poland with a foreign driving license?
Yes, tourists can use their foreign driving license for up to 6 months. After that, you will require to convert your license to a Polish one.
